Transaction 4902bd3ec9198d8795170f140b9302f3b97f733340e655fdde1622313f1545ee
1 Input
2 Outputs
- 4902bd3ec9198d8795170f140b9302f3b97f733340e655fdde1622313f1545ee:0
- 4902bd3ec9198d8795170f140b9302f3b97f733340e655fdde1622313f1545ee:1
value 10010396
address 3CYsDTocLdVKZb3PvdJ6o7HpWT4xiK6E6n
value 8243886
address 1B94CGEjAzvWnZvDi9khuP5WaexZL4M49w